Indonesian streetwear brands like Erigo, Roughneck 1991, and Damn! I Love Indonesia are incredibly popular. Furthermore, youth are modernising traditional textiles. It is now common to see young people wearing Batik or Tenun shirts styled with oversized hoodies, cargo pants, and local sneakers like Compass. Culinary Innovations

Language is a fluid, evolving playground for young Indonesians. The most prominent linguistic trend is the rise of "Anak Jaksel" (South Jakarta Kid) slang.
